New Day Blessed
The lanterns glint through flames of night
when musings dwell, to rise, to soar
unto a breeze, in orange-white
and with lit murmurs, troubles beseech…
soft the prayers as hands implore,
one rhapsody like sacred speech.
Unyielding, angel wings unfold
the rise and ebb of hopeful dreams
beneath glazed stars, touching eve’s cold…
for human faith opens god’s sky,
endowing a new day, agleam
as wishes claim heaven’s reply.
The lanterns glint through flames of night
Unyielding, laced wings unfold.
